Disturbing Images Reveal Young Bear Chained to Tree, Savaged by Vicious Dogs in Russian ‘Hunting’ Contest

These shocking pictures show a young bear being chained to a tree and attacked by dogs as part of a baiting competition to hone hunting skills in Yakutsk, eastern Russia.
